operationadd into favorites/ˌɑːpəˈɹeɪʃən/, /ˌɒpə(ɹ)ˈeɪʃən/, /ˌɒpəˈɹeɪʃən/
EN    UK    US    AU    
Etymology: [ "ä-p&-'rA-sh&n ] (noun.) 14th century. From Latin operari (“to work”), from opus, operis (“work”)
Synonyms: function, transformation, act, action, activity, affair, agency, application, ballgame, bit, carrying on, conveyance, course, deal, deed, doing, effect, effort, employment
Antonyms: idleness, inaction, inutility, uselessness
